Energy af Mind Map: Energy

1. Work

1.1. Power

1.1.1. Rate at which work is performed

1.1.2. Power = Work/Time

1.1.3. Measured in Watts (W)

1.2. Work = Force x Displacement

1.3. Transfer of energy that occurs when a force makes an object move

1.4. 1. Force must be applied

1.5. 2. Motion must be in same direction as applied force

1.6. Measured in Joules (J)

2. Capacity to do work

3. Law of Conservation of Energy (Energy cannot be created 'nor destroyed)

3.1. Conservative Forces

3.1.1. Gravity

3.1.2. electrical

3.2. Non-Conservative Forces

3.2.1. Friction

3.2.2. Air Resistance

3.2.3. Still conserve energy, energy just becomes thermal

4. Mechanical Energy

4.1. Potential Energy

4.1.1. Due to position or deformation

4.1.2. 4 Types:

4.1.2.1. Gravitational

4.1.2.1.1. U=mgh

4.1.2.1.2. Stored energy from height (ability to fall)

4.1.2.2. Elastic

4.1.2.2.1. object stretched or compressed (springs)

4.1.2.3. Chemical

4.1.2.4. Strain

4.1.2.4.1. Amount of deformation

4.1.2.4.2. Stiffness

4.1.2.4.3. U=1/2kx^2

4.1.3. Represented by PE or U

4.2. Kinetic Energy

4.2.1. Due to motion

4.2.2. Depends on mass & velocity

4.2.3. Represented by KE or K

4.2.4. K=1/2mv^2

5. Measured in Joules (J)

5.1. Joules = Newtons x Meters (J=Nm)
